Autonomous construction—driven by robotics, drones, and artificial intelligence—seeks to revolutionize the industry by reducing human error and enhancing safety and productivity. Concrete, known for its durability and versatility, serves as the backbone for such advancements. With the advent of 3D printing technology, concrete is being used in novel ways, shaping structures with complex geometries that were once deemed impossible. This shift not only reduces waste but also speeds up the construction process significantly.

The incorporation of smart concrete in autonomous construction is another groundbreaking development. Smart concrete is designed with sensors embedded within, allowing real-time data collection about the structure's health, such as stress levels and temperature changes.
